Decoding the Cost of Clear Vision: Why Glasses are So Pricey
Stepping into an eyeglass store can feel like entering a world where clarity comes with a hefty bill. While it's tempting to attribute high eyewear prices to exorbitant profits, the truth is more nuanced. A pair of glasses isn't just a stylish accessory; it's a sophisticated piece of technology that requires expert craftsmanship and premium materials.
- The lenses themselves are a major factor, with different types impacting the cost. Consider glass lenses, each offering varying levels of durability.
- Frames also contribute to the overall expense. A wider variety of materials like metal, along with intricate designs, can greatly affect the final price.
- Don't forget about the knowledge of the technician who adjusts your glasses to ensure a perfect alignment. Their labor is an invaluable ingredient in achieving optimal vision.
